**Shortlisted, Queensland Literary Awards 2026, Judith Wright Calanthe Award**

What are the appropriate emotions. Even with a map, it was difficult to determine. An ache which means let go. If she didn't have the thought, she wouldn't have the feeling.

Zarah Butcher-McGunnigle's Leaves Fall Off to Create Drama is a collection of prose poems that invites the reader to consider the relationships between internalised beliefs and the development of illness, drawing on psychology texts and the language of self-help, and the exploration of character traits and dramatic tropes. Wheels fall off to create drama. Through shifting frames of reference, wordplay, aphorism, and inversions, the poems reform, unfold and rebound to create a collage of melancholy and comic transformations. One thing leads to a mother. Butcher-McGunnigle's poems explore the relationship between unexamined subconscious thinking and physical and mental health, resisting singular, fixed meanings and inviting the reader to reflect on their own experiences.
